Do you still need a radar if your car has a reverse camera?

A car with a reverse camera still needs a radar. The reverse camera can only display images within a fixed range, while the reverse radar can monitor a larger area. When reversing the vehicle, it can enhance the safety of the reversing process. Additionally, the reverse radar will emit an audible alert when encountering obstacles. The reverse radar, also known as an anti-collision radar, serves as the most basic parking assistance system. It emits ultrasonic waves through ultrasonic sensors, which reflect back after hitting obstacles and are received again by the ultrasonic sensors. The controller calculates the distance between the vehicle and the obstacle based on the time taken for the ultrasonic waves to be emitted and reflected back, and alerts the driver with a rapid alarm sound through the warning device.

As a veteran driver with over a decade of experience, I've personally experienced the convenience of reversing cameras but also deeply understand the necessity of parking sensors. Back when my car had a high-definition camera, I thought everything was perfect—until one time during a heavy rainstorm while reversing, rainwater obscured the lens, making it completely blurry. I couldn't see an abandoned trash bin behind me at all. Fortunately, the sensors beeped in time, allowing me to brake urgently and avoid a collision. While cameras provide a clear visual, they are highly affected by lighting and environmental conditions, such as poor performance at night or in thick fog. Sensors, however, can detect surrounding obstacles, especially those that are low or hidden in blind spots. In real-life scenarios, using both together is the safest approach—the camera gives you a clear view, while the sensors alert you to distances. My advice is not to skimp on this small expense; installing sensors as a backup is cost-effective and can prevent repair costs and accidents. Safety comes first—never rely solely on one feature when driving.

As a family-oriented driver who prioritizes safety, I believe both rearview cameras and parking radars are indispensable because they complement each other perfectly. The camera acts like eyes, displaying real-time rear images to help you judge positioning, while the radar functions like ears, using sensors to detect object distances and issue alerts. With a large family and frequent school runs, I once experienced a situation in a school parking lot where the camera showed an empty space, but the radar suddenly beeped – it turned out a child had darted by, which the camera failed to capture immediately. Cameras may lag during movement or in low-light conditions, whereas radars provide real-time detection of blind spot hazards. Considering weather impacts like snow obscuring camera views, radars prove more reliable. From a safety perspective, using both systems significantly reduces collision risks, especially against pets or small obstacles. Ultimately, an extra layer of protection means greater peace of mind, making this modest investment absolutely worthwhile.

What engine does the Citroen C-Quatre have?

The Citroen C-Quatre is equipped with either a 1.6L naturally aspirated engine or a 2.0L naturally aspirated engine, delivering a maximum power output of 78 kW at 5,750 rpm and a peak torque of 142 Nm. This vehicle is a 5-seater, 4-door compact sedan under Dongfeng Citroen, with exterior dimensions measuring 4,556 mm in length, 1,773 mm in width, and 1,486 mm in height. It features a wheelbase of 2,610 mm and a trunk capacity of 481 liters. The car comes with MacPherson strut front independent suspension, a deformable crossbeam rear suspension with stabilizer bar, brake assist system, aluminum alloy wheels, and cruise control.

Can the car's air conditioning cool without starting the engine?

Ordinary fuel-powered vehicles cannot, because the air conditioning in conventional fuel-powered cars is driven by the engine. If the car is not started, the air conditioning cannot be used. Below is relevant information: 1. Car air conditioning system: The car air conditioning system is a device that cools, heats, ventilates, and purifies the air inside the vehicle compartment. It provides a comfortable environment for passengers, reduces driver fatigue, and enhances driving safety. Different types of air conditioning systems have varying layouts. 2. What is the tire specification of the Prado?

The tire specification of the Prado is 265/60R18. The vehicle is now officially called the Prado and is an SUV under FAW Toyota. Its exterior dimensions are 4840mm in length, 1885mm in width, and 1890m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2790mm. It is equipped with a 3.5-liter naturally aspirated engine and a manual-automatic transmission, delivering a maximum power of 206 kW at 6000 rpm and a maximum torque of 365 Nm. The vehicle features a double-wishbone independent front suspension, a four-link non-independent rear suspension, engine start-stop technology, tire pressure display, and cruise control.

How many types of car chassis armor are there?

There are four types of car chassis armor, namely: 1. Asphalt-based chassis anti-rust glue; 2. Oil-based solvent chassis anti-rust glue; 3. Water-soluble chassis anti-rust glue; 4. Composite polymer resin paint. Car chassis armor is a high-tech adhesive rubber asphalt coating used for anti-collision, anti-rust, and sound insulation of the car chassis. The functional characteristics of car chassis armor are: 1. Chassis anti-corrosion; 2. Preventing stone impacts on the bottom plate during driving; 3. Eliminating resonance generated by the engine, wheels, and bottom plate, providing shock absorption; 4. Reducing noise generated between the vehicle and the ground during driving; 5. Preventing underbody scraping and reducing the degree of damage to the chassis.
